The AAPC Certified Professional Coder (CPC) is administered by AAPC and runs 100 questions / 4 hours, with a passing score of 70%. The current exam fee is $399 USD. The official candidate handbook and registration is available from the AAPC directly: view the official exam page →

The NCLEX exams are administered by the National Council of State Boards of Nursing (NCSBN); the Praxis-style certifications for medical assisting, coding (CPC, CCS) and pharmacy technician work are board-administered through AAPC, AHIMA and PTCB respectively.
